If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>. */ package eu.europa.ec.markt.dss.validation102853.ocsp; import java.security.cert.X509Certificate; import java.util.Date; import java.util.List; import org.bouncycastle.cert.ocsp.BasicOCSPResp; import org.bouncycastle.cert.ocsp.CertificateID; import org.bouncycastle.cert.ocsp.SingleResp; import org.slf4j.Logger; import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ory; import eu.europa.ec.markt.dss.DSSRevocationUtils; /** * Abstract class that helps to implement an OCSPSource with an already loaded list of BasicOCSPResp * * @version $Revision$ - $Date$ */ public abstract class OfflineOCSPSource implements OCSPSource { private static final Logger LOG = LoggerFactory.getLogger(OfflineOCSPSource.class); @Override final public BasicOCSPResp getOCSPResponse(final X509Certificate x509Certificate, final X509Certificate issuerX509Certificate) { /** * TODO: (Bob 2013.05.08) Does the OCSP responses always use SHA1?<br> * RFC 2560:<br> * CertID ::= SEQUENCE {<br> * hashAlgorithm AlgorithmIdentifier,<br> * issuerNameHash OCTET STRING, -- Hash of Issuer's DN<br> * issuerKeyHash OCTET STRING, -- Hash of Issuer's public key<br> * serialNumber CertificateSerialNumber }<br> * * ... The hash algorithm used for both these hashes, is identified in hashAlgorithm. serialNumber is the * serial number of the cert for which status is being requested. */ Date bestUpdate = null; BasicOCSPResp bestBasicOCSPResp = null; final CertificateID certId = DSSRevocationUtils.getOCSPCertificateID(x509Certificate, issuerX509Certificate); for (final BasicOCSPResp basicOCSPResp : getContainedOCSPResponses()) { for (final SingleResp singleResp : basicOCSPResp.getResponses()) { if (DSSRevocationUtils.matches(certId, singleResp)) { final Date thisUpdate = singleResp.getThisUpdate(); if (bestUpdate == null || thisUpdate.after(bestUpdate)) { bestBasicOCSPResp = basicOCSPResp; bestUpdate = thisUpdate; } } } } return bestBasicOCSPResp; } /** * Retrieves the list of {@code BasicOCSPResp} contained in the source. * * @return {@code List} of {@code BasicOCSPResp}s */ public abstract List<BasicOCSPResp> getContainedOCSPResponses(); }
